Output 5f088768a03dbc502fba33e7b5beb51f139d7c7844b7765089fdf5d81643e5e4:1

value
418940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c03bc9cac6e8e3d874af53645ebb2f7c2c9aac OP_EQUAL
address
3DRnhifLaZeBzvAkx9cS8pkXRb4PUGtVGx
transaction
5f088768a03dbc502fba33e7b5beb51f139d7c7844b7765089fdf5d81643e5e4
confirmations
306251
spent
true